Popular Welding Certificates
Although the American Welding Society’s basic CW credential helps make you eligible for almost all jobs, a number of industries demand their own specific certificate. Several of the most-widely used of which are listed below.
- ASME Certification for individuals that deal with boiler and pressure containers
- CW Certificates to become a Certified Welder
- American Petroleum Institute Certification for welders who work with pipelines in the gas and oil industry
-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certifications for inspectors and senior inspectors

This table illustrates wage and job projections for professional welders in the State of Missouri through the end of the decade.
| Missouri |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 8,150 | 8,580 | 5% | 240 |
| Missouri |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$22,100 | $34,700 | $49,400 |
Source: O*Net Online
The Basics of Welding Specialist Courses
Selecting which program to go to is obviously an individual choice, but here are some items you should know before choosing certified welding schools. You could possibly hear that welding classes are all similar, yet there are certain things you will want to be aware of before picking which brazing courses to sign up for in Rocky Mount, MO. Remember to see whether the training schools have been accredited either with a governing agency like the AWS. Right after taking a look at the accreditation status, you will need to explore a bit deeper to make sure that the training program you are considering can supply you with the right instruction.
- Make certain the program trains on machinery that meets present field guidelines
- See if the facility gives financial assistance
- Make sure that the college’s program offers training in SMAW, GMAW, GTAW and pipe welding
- Choose institutions that satisfy AWS SENSE standards
